WebA host key is a cryptographic key used for authenticating computers in the SSH protocol. Host keys are key pairs, typically using the RSA, DSA, or ECDSA algorithms. WebJul 25, 2013 · Step 1: remove potentially duplicated host key. rm /etc/ssh/ssh_host_*. Step 2: regenerate host keys. /usr/sbin/dpkg-reconfigure openssh-server.
